**1. ** Broadening Your Knowledge:
One of the most obvious benefits of learning more is the expansion of your knowledge base. Whether you're delving into a new subject, refining existing skills, or exploring a hobby, each learning experience adds to your wealth of knowledge. This newfound expertise can be applied to various aspects of your life, from problem-solving to decision-making.
**2. ** Professional Advancement:
In the professional realm, continuous learning is often the path to career advancement. Acquiring new skills and staying up-to-date with industry trends can make you a valuable asset to your employer. It can open doors to promotions, salary increases, and new job opportunities.
**3. ** Adaptability:
In today's rapidly evolving world, adaptability is a prized quality. Learning more equips you with the tools to adapt to changing circumstances and technologies. This adaptability is especially crucial in fields where innovation and change are constant, such as technology, healthcare, and finance.
**4. ** Problem-Solving Skills:
Learning isn't just about accumulating facts; it's about developing critical thinking and problem-solving skills. As you encounter and overcome challenges in your learning journey, you enhance your ability to tackle complex problems in both your personal and professional life.
**5. ** Enhanced Communication:
Effective communication is a cornerstone of success. Learning more about communication techniques, active listening, and emotional intelligence can significantly improve your ability to convey ideas, collaborate with others, and build strong relationships.
**6. ** Personal Fulfillment:
Learning isn't solely about career advancement—it's also about personal fulfillment. Pursuing your interests and passions through learning can bring immense joy and satisfaction. Whether you're learning to play a musical instrument, mastering a new language, or exploring art, these pursuits add depth and meaning to your life.
**7. ** Networking Opportunities:
Engaging in learning experiences, such as workshops, seminars, or online courses, can introduce you to like-minded individuals and experts in your field. Networking can lead to valuable connections, mentorship opportunities, and collaborations that boost your professional growth.
**8. ** Continuous Improvement:
Learning more is a testament to your commitment to self-improvement. It demonstrates a growth mindset, a willingness to embrace challenges, and a desire to become the best version of yourself. This attitude sets you on a trajectory of continuous improvement.
**9. ** Resilience:
Through learning, you build resilience—the ability to bounce back from setbacks and adapt to adversity. Resilience is a valuable trait in both personal and professional contexts, as it helps you navigate life's ups and downs with grace and determination.
**10. ** Inspiration to Others:
Your dedication to learning can inspire those around you, including colleagues, friends, and family members. Your pursuit of knowledge can serve as a model for others to follow, fostering a culture of growth and improvement.
